The Only Two Things That Matter in a Gold Ring
When you're looking for a gold ring, the market will drown you in options. 10k, 14k, 18k, 24k. Rose gold, yellow gold, white gold. Words like "alloy," "finish," and "trend" are thrown around to create a sense of complexity.
Cut through the noise. I've handled thousands of rings over the years, from simple bands to complex custom pieces. When it comes down to it, you only need to focus on two things to make a choice you won't regret.
1. Durability for Your Real Life
A ring isn’t meant to sit in a box. It’s meant to be worn. It will knock against desks, get caught on clothes, and be exposed to the elements of your daily life. Its ability to withstand this is paramount.
Many brands will tout the purity of 18k gold as a mark of luxury. In my experience, for a ring you plan to wear every day, 14k gold often offers a superior balance. It has more strengthening alloys, which makes it noticeably tougher against scratches and dents.
No need to dive into complicated metallurgy. You just need to remember this: your ring must be strong enough for your lifestyle. For most people, that means 14k is the most practical, intelligent choice for long-term wear.
